Data Scientist, GBG Data Science

2 months ago


Menlo Park, United States META Full time

The massive scale and heavy engagement of the people using our products make the Meta ads platform the most powerful growth vehicle for businesses in the world. The team is driving advancements in ad auction and ad delivery research, developing/vetting advanced advertising tactics, and bootstrapping new products that meet large but nuanced use cases of complex advertisers. In this role, you will delve into the multifaceted ad ranking product stack, employing advanced modeling, and machine learning to unravel the complexities of modern advertising. You must also be able to work with external marketers as this role will give you the opportunity to meet with the most sophisticated advertisers to understand their pain points, build product intuition, and drive nuanced understanding externally. By deeply understanding our ads products and advertiser use cases you will discover novel problems and regularly drive meaningful business impact. The team is made up of data scientists with a diverse set of backgrounds. Specifically, we have team members with various levels of academic attainment (Bachelor's, Master's and PhD), work experience, and professional backgrounds. The ideal candidate for this position is a versatile data scientist that excels in machine learning, statistical inference, data visualization, data analysis, and writing code. They should be excited to learn a complicated new technical domain and deploy a data science skill set to challenge core assumptions about that domain. They must have solid product intuition and be willing to talk to customers to develop and challenge that intuition. They will have a proven track record of analyzing and deriving insights from data. They will be intellectually curious, a great communicator, data-driven, a fast learner, and able to move fast while keeping focused on high-impact projects. As this team is fundamentally focused on R&D, the candidate must be comfortable with ambiguity and answering broad research questions.

Data Scientist, GBG Data Science Responsibilities

  • Apply analytical skills to complex quantitative problems, presenting and driving actions from insights to key stakeholders both reactively and proactively
  • Develop deep understanding of the Meta ads auction, analyzing a dynamic system and developing new optimizations for ad delivery and marketing strategies
  • Research applied machine learning questions in our ads ranking to improve system efficiency and drive company wide understanding
  • Identify novel marketing strategies for improving advertiser performance across Meta's ads auction
  • Work closely with our sales and cross-functional teams, as well as advertisers directly to build product intuition and to identify, analyze, and scale performance opportunities
  • Present polished findings and recommendations directly to stakeholders
  • Elevate key themes to our product teams and alpha testing of new opportunities
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Mathematics, Statistics, a relevant technical field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• Experience doing statistical analysis (e.g. regression, probability) using tools such as Python, R, MATLAB, SPSS, SAS, Stata, etc.
  • Experience in building, validating, and deploying predictive models using machine learning libraries like scikit-lear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ch
  • Experience with data visualization tools such as Matplotlib, Seaborn, Tableau, etc
  • Experience in working with large datasets and using SQL or similar tools for data extraction and manipulation
  • Experience delivering and driving action based on data-driven insights
  • Experience influencing and partnering with stakeholders across organizations
  • 3+ years of analytics experience
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, relevant technical field, or equivalent practical experience.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Advanced degree in an analytical field (such as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, Statistics, Physics, Economics, Finance, etc)
  • Strong programming skills to prototype solutions that are deployed in production environments
  • Experience with experimental design
  • Experience with digital advertising or ads monetization
